What are the ingredients in Don Miguel breakfast burritos?

Answered by Arthur Reyes

The Don Miguel breakfast burritos contain a variety of ingredients that come together to create a delicious and satisfying meal. Let's take a closer look at each of these ingredients and their characteristics:

1. Whole eggs: These eggs provide a rich and creamy texture to the burrito filling. Eggs are a versatile ingredient and are known for their high protein content, making them a great addition to a breakfast meal.

2. Sausage: The sausage used in Don Miguel breakfast burritos is made from a combination of pork and a blend of spices. This adds a savory and slightly spicy flavor to the burrito. Sausage is a popular breakfast meat that pairs well with eggs and cheese.

3. Three cheeses: Don Miguel breakfast burritos feature a combination of three cheeses. One of these cheeses is pasteurized process American cheese, which has a smooth and creamy texture. The other two cheeses are not specifically mentioned, but they likely add additional flavor and richness to the burrito.

4. Salt: Salt is a common ingredient used to enhance the flavor of food. It helps to balance the flavors in the breakfast burrito filling and brings out the natural flavors of the other ingredients.

5. Spices: The sausage in the burrito filling is seasoned with a blend of spices. These spices could include ingredients like black pepper, garlic powder, paprika, and red pepper flakes. The spices add depth and complexity to the overall flavor profile of the burrito.

6. Dextrose: Dextrose is a simple sugar derived from corn and is used as a sweetener in the breakfast burrito filling. It helps to balance out any savory or spicy flavors and adds a touch of sweetness to the overall taste.

7. Sugar: Similar to dextrose, sugar is added to the burrito filling for a touch of sweetness. It can help to enhance the flavors of the other ingredients and create a more well-rounded taste.

8. Maltodextrin: Maltodextrin is a carbohydrate derived from starches and is commonly used as a thickener or filler in processed foods. It may be used in the burrito filling to give it a slightly thicker consistency.

9. Natural flavor: The term “natural flavor” is quite broad and can encompass a wide range of ingredients derived from natural sources. It is used to enhance the taste of the burrito filling and can come from various sources such as spices, herbs, or extracts.

10. Disodium inosinate and disodium guanylate: These are flavor enhancers often used in combination with monosodium glutamate (MSG). They help to intensify the savory flavors in the burrito filling and provide a more robust taste experience.

11. Sodium citrate and sodium phosphates: These ingredients are food additives that help to improve the texture and stability of the cheese in the breakfast burritos. They also act as emulsifiers, preventing the cheese from separating or becoming greasy.

12. Color (annatto and/or paprika extract): Annatto and paprika extract are natural food colorings derived from the seeds of the achiote tree and the spice paprika, respectively. They are used to give the cheese in the burrito filling a yellow-orange color.
